Stewart, Ward R. – Mathematics Teacher, 1974
Students, playing the game described, develop strategies for guessing the four-digit number chosen by the opponent. The rules of the game are easily understood by low achievers, yet strategy development is challenging to advanced students. The game can be extended to numbers having more digits. (SD)

Bruni, James V.; Silverman, Helene – Arithmetic Teacher, 1974
Wooden cubes can be used with task cards and teacher-made materials to develop and reinforce learning of linear measurement, area and multiplication, volume and surface area. Students can use cubes to cover area and fill boxes; later they learn to make boxes to fit specified numbers of cubes. (SD)
